PM to chair 32nd interaction through PRAGATI platform today New Delhi, jan 21 Prime Minister Shri Narendra Modi will chair the 32nd interaction through PRAGATI- the Information and Communications Technology-based, multi- modal platform for Pro- Active Governance and Timely Implementation tomorrow (Jan 22). In the previous thirty-one interactions of PRAGATI, projects worth over twelve lakh crores have been reviewed by the Prime Minister. In the last PRAGATI meeting, nine projects worth over 61 thousand crore rupees related to 16 States and the Union Territory of Jammu and Kashmir were taken up for discussion. There were also discussions on various topics like grievances of Indian citizens working abroad, National Agriculture Market, Aspirational District Programme and infrastructure development programmes and initiatives. Prime Minister had launched the multi- purpose and multi-modal governance platform PRAGATI on 25th March 2015. PRAGATI is an integrating and interactive platform aimed at addressing the grievances of common people. PRAGATI also helps in simultaneously monitoring and reviewing important programmes and projects of the Centre as well as projects flagged by various State Governments. Birth anniversary celebration of Netaji Subhash Chandra Bose on Jan 23 Port Blair, Jan 21 The Andaman Public Works Department (APWD) has finalized the Master Plan for Port Blair Planning/Development Area (PBPA) which consists of present Port Blair town and 26 revenue villages around it. It was approved by the Administration and notified in the Gazette vide No. 35 dated 01/03/2012. Subsequently, a modification proposal has been contemplated within the ambit of the provisions of Sub-Section-(1) of Section-9 of Andaman & Nicobar Islands Town & Country Planning Regulation, 1994 in the interest of general public and others. Accordingly, a draft modification proposal on the Master Plan for Port Blair Planning/ Development Area was published in the Official Gazette and in two local dailies circulated in the Port Blair Planning Area in addition to publishing it in the website of the Administration as required under Sub- Section (3) of Section-9 of Andaman and Nicobar Islands Town and Country Planning Regulation, 1994 for inviting suggestions/objections from all stakeholders including general public within 45 days from the date of their publication vide Notification No. 122/ 2018/ F.No. TP-21/CE/ 2017/48(PF) dated 08/05/ 2018. By taking into account of the objections/ suggestions received in the matter, the modifications on the Master Plan for Port Blair Planning Area has been finalized and approved by the Lt. Governor (Administrator), Andaman and Nicobar Islands. The contents of modification of the Master Plan for PBPA includes procedure for settlement of dispute in the boundaries of Reserved Forest and Defence landuse zones, definition of the permissible activities in the Parks & Open Space landuse zone & the Planning Norms for such activities, rationalization of front, rear and side setbacks, balcony projections etc. The modification on the Master Plan for Port Blair Planning Area/ Development Area shall come into operation from the date of publication of this notification in A&N Gazette. (Contd. on last page) (Contd. on last page) (Contd. on last page) (Contd. on last page) Port Blair, Jan 21 The Chairman and Independent Member of Electricity Consumer Grievances Redressal Forum will conduct 'Public Hearing' at Ferrargunj village to listen and redress grievances of Electricity Consumers. The Forum will conduct the Hearings in Ferrargunj Panchayat Samiti Community Hall, Ferrargunj on 25.01.2020 at 11 am. Aggrieved Electricity Consumers in the said areas may avail the opportunity. The complainant consumers Public hearing for electricity consumers at Ferrargunj are requested to bring copy of their last paid electricity bill along with them in proof of their being consumers of the Electricity Department. The Forum is a quasi judiciary body established under the aegis of Joint Electricity Regulatory Commission constituted under Section 42 of Electricity Act, 2003. The Orders passed by the Forum is obligatory on the part of the Licensee (Electricity Department) for compliance, a communication from Chairman, CGRF said. (Contd. on last page) Port Blair, Jan 21 An information was received at 1 pm today at PS Aberdeen through PCR that a two year old child is missing from Prem Nagar near Uma Bakery. Immediately, a team was formed under the leadership of Insp. Sanjay Kumar, SHO PS Aberdeen and swung into action. After extensive search & efforts of the team, the minor boy was recovered from a drain opposite to Hotel TSG Emrald, Phoenix Bay and immediately evacuated to GB Pant Hospital, Port Blair. On enquiry, it was ascertained that the father had dropped his kid and wife to his brother's house at Prem Nagar. The minor boy while playing in front PS Aberdeen traces out missing infant within hours of his house, entered in a drain which led towards Phoenix Bay but nobody noticed the same. Meanwhile, a large number of people were gathered with presumption about the rumors of child lifter in the town but the swift action of police once again proved that no such incident is apparently occurring in the city and quelled the rumors. People have again been requested not to indulge themselves in such unenthusiastic rumors to avoid any untoward incidents. They may pass on information with Police in case of any suspicious activities to 100/112 & 03192-233077, a communication from the SP (SA) said here today.

Innsbruck(Austria), Jan 21 Ace Indian shooters ApurviChandela and Divyansh SinghPanwar clinched gold at theongoing Meyton Cupinternational shootingchampionship in Austria.Apurvi won the gold in women's10m air rifle with a final score of251.4. Anjum Moudgil had tosettle for bronze in the sameevent with a final score of 229.In men's 10m air rifle, Divyanshbagged the top honours with afinal score of 249.7 whileDeepak Kumar had to settle forbronze with a score of 228.All the four Indian shootershave already earned Olympicquotas for Tokyo Games.Anjum and Apurvi won Olympicquotas for Tokyo 2020 when

Apurvi Chandela shoots10m air rifle gold at Meyton Cup

the former won silver and thelatter finished fourth at the 2018Shooting WorldChampionships held inChangwon, South Korea.Anjum and Apurvi had wonOlympic quotas for Tokyo 2020when the former won silver andthe latter finished fourth at the2018 Shooting WorldChampionships held in

Changwon, South Korea.Divyansh had earned theOlympic quota by clinching asilver medal at the ISSF WorldCup in Beijing in 2019 whileDeepak had secured the quotain the same discipline afterwinning bronze at the 14thAsian Championships in Doha.The Tokyo Olympics will kick-off from July 24.
